Optimizing the Performance of the Mandatory Proportion of Employment of People with Disabilities
Jiroutová, Kateřina ; Kyrych, Vladimír (referee) ; Musilová, Helena (advisor)
The bachelor thesis focuses on optimizing the performance of the mandatory proportion of employment of people with disabilities. It compares a few possibilities of performance and their combinations. It analyses current variant of performance of the chosen employer and suggests suitable solution of performance. It shows possibility how to employ people with disabilities.

Employment of a New Employee while Reducing Costs of His Remuneration
Houfková, Andrea ; Grebíková, Monika (referee) ; Musilová, Helena (advisor)
This thesis deals with labour relations, specifically the creation of employment. It focuses on possibilities how to save the cost of a new employee remuneration using subsidies from the Labour Office and employing of a disabled person. By analyzing the expected costs of remuneration and by finding of the actual subsidies from the relevant Labour Office branch, the thesis will propose options to a businesswoman Jitka Houfková how she could reduce these costs. Jitka Houfková will also be recommended an option of achieving the highest savings.
